Back then there was deffinitly a color barrier and black artists were enjoyed by black artists and not given air time except for the occasional few. MTV as we know it was no exception however according to The Austin Chronicle, Jackson's video for the song "Billie Jean" was the video that broke the color barrier, even though the channel itself was responsible for erecting that barrier in the first place. After airing Jackson's music videos, MTV, then a struggling cable channel, became very popular. Jackson's videos were credited for this success and MTV's focus switched from rock to pop and R&B. This move helped other black artists such as Prince and Whitney Houston break into heavy rotation on the channel.
